Add expected salary to your profile for insights We're seeking a highly experienced Senior Development Manager to lead the planning, delivery, and financial performance of multiple projects in our portfolio.
You will work across the entire project lifecycle, from feasibility and approvals through to construction, sales, and customer experience.
Beyond technical delivery, you'll collaborate closely with the management team to develop and oversee Sales, Marketing, and Customer Service strategies for each project, ensuring communities launch successfully, resonate with our customers, and deliver strong commercial outcomes.
Key Responsibilities · Lead project lifecycle from acquisition feasibility to delivery, including design, approvals, procurement, construction, sales, marketing and handover; · Partner with leadership to prepare Sales, Marketing, and Customer Service strategies, and oversee their implementation; · Drive feasibility modelling, financial forecasting, and project returns analysis; · Manage budgets, monitor costs, and ensure projects achieve financial KPIs; · Liaise with architects, contractors, consultants, and approval authorities; · Oversee quality, compliance, permits, and performance monitoring; · Provide leadership to internal and external project teams; and · Report regularly to management on project progress, risks, and financial performance.
About You · Tertiary qualification in relevant related field; · Extensive experience in residential, land lease or MPC developments; · Strong skills in feasibility, project finance, budget management, and cost control; · Proven track record in regulatory approvals and stakeholder management; · Experience formulating Sales, Marketing, and Customer Service strategies tied to development delivery; · Excellent leadership, decision-making, problem-solving and communication skills; · End-to-end project experience across development, construction, sales, and customer service; and · Relentless attention to detail and commitment to excellence.
What We Offer · A permanent, full-time role based in Sydney (Bondi Junction office location); · Opportunity to lead delivery on lifestyle resorts that set a new benchmark for over 55s living; · Collaborative team culture with autonomy and trust; · Attractive salary package; and · Be part of a well-respected team with a growing national footprint.
About Us Clifton Lifestyle is a privately-owned developer, owner, and operator of over 55s lifestyle communities.
Our mission is to create exceptional land lease resorts that provide affordability, quality, and a strong sense of community for independent retirees across Australia.
